What are Old Style Christmas Lights Called?

The glittering bulbs that defined the 90s Christmas lights aesthetic are known in decorating circles by a few nostalgic names. Most recognizably, C9 and C7 bulbs dominated the era, with their chunky, jewel-toned glass and warm incandescent glow. “Bubble lights”—filled with mysterious colored liquids—were a favorite on indoor trees. “Flicker flame” bulbs were also common, imitating the dancing flame of a candlelight for a welcoming, vintage appeal. Old Style Lights vs Modern LED: Design and Electricity Usage

The greatest distinction between old style lights and modern options is their energy consumption and longevity. Traditional incandescent C9/C7 bulbs devoured more power and emitted significant heat. A 25-bulb string could use up to 175 watts! Today’s LEDs capture the same classic glow while slashing electricity use—often to less than 5 watts per string. The appeal goes beyond cost savings: LEDs also last much longer (up to 10 seasons or more) and are less likely to shatter during storage. Comparison Table: 90s Christmas Lights Aesthetic—Incandescent vs. LED
Feature Incandescent LED
Cost (Per String) $8-15
(plus replacement bulbs over time)
$12-20
(longer life, rarely replaced)
Energy Use Up to 175W per 25 bulbs Less than 5W per 25 bulbs
Longevity 1–2 holiday seasons 5–10 years
Color/Glow Rich, warm, diffuse Crisp, saturated, tunable warmth

What are Firefly Christmas Lights?

Firefly Christmas lights, though modern in technology, evoke the twinkling magic of the 90s Christmas lights aesthetic. These micro-LED strings flicker gently, often strung on flexible wire, mimicking the look of fireflies and the soft, subtle motion found in classic displays. Firefly lights are a favorite for both indoor and outdoor decorating—wrapping trees, illuminating wreaths, and accenting centerpieces. Look for fissures, thickness consistency, and structural integrity to avoid surprises." — Riley Material Choices: Granite, Quartz, Marble, or Quartzite — What Homeowners Need to Know With so many stunning materials on the market, choosing your ideal surface comes down to more than aesthetics. As Riley explains, "Each material offers different benefits—and potential drawbacks—when it comes to durability, upkeep, and cost." Granite is beloved for its one-of-a-kind character, quartz for its impervious durability, marble for its timeless elegance, and quartzite for mimicking the look of stone with the strength of engineered surfaces. Homeowners should weigh not just color and pattern, but how their surface will weather daily life. How resistant is the slab to stains, scratching, or heat? Is the cost justified by your usage and the frequency of maintenance? Armed with facts—not hearsay—you will be able to confidently select the surface that best aligns with both your vision and your day-to-day demands. Material Durability Maintenance Cost Range Aesthetic Granite High Moderate Mid Natural stone with diverse patterns Quartz Very High Low Mid to High Consistent pattern, non-porous Marble Medium High High Elegant veining, softer surface Quartzite Very High Low to Moderate High Stone look with hardness of quartz The Fabrication and Installation Journey: What to Expect and How to Prepare One of the leading anxieties for homeowners is the prospect of lengthy, disruptive installation—or worse, having the final result not match their expectations. Relying solely on samples or photos without viewing full slabs Overlooking structural integrity factors like fissures and thickness Not understanding material-specific functional differences Ignoring seam placement which affects aesthetics Underestimating realistic project timelines Navigating Material Choices: Granite, Quartz, Marble, and Quartzite Demystified Functional Differences Every Homeowner Should Understand Kitchen countertop material selection can be daunting, especially when terms like granite, quartz, marble, and quartzite are casually interchanged. Riley Tatton demystifies these choices with practical clarity. He explains that each material comes with its own set of functional trade-offs: granite boasts high durability and natural patterns but requires moderate sealing, while quartz offers extreme durability and minimal maintenance with a consistent appearance. Marble delivers luxurious veining and timeless charm but demands delicate care, making it better suited for zones where fashion, not heavy function, is the goal. Quartzite, Tatton notes, combines natural beauty with durability—acting as a marble alternative that can withstand the rigors of a busy kitchen. The expert’s advice is to always match the material’s inherent characteristics with your family’s lifestyle and habits. For homeowners in Temecula, where kitchens often serve as gathering hubs, choosing the right surface isn’t just about today’s style—it’s planning for everyday enjoyment and future-proof resilience. Tatton urges buyers to rely on in-depth consultations and side-by-side sample analysis, rather than simply chasing trends or budget pricing. The right partner will turn material selection into an education, empowering you to invest wisely for years to come. Material Durability Maintenance Visual Appeal Best For Granite High Moderate sealing required Natural patterns & colors Heavy-use kitchens Quartz Very high Low maintenance Uniform look with color options Family kitchens Marble Moderate High maintenance, prone to staining Luxurious veining Low-use, aesthetic-focused areas Quartzite High Low maintenance Natural veining, marble-like Durable and elegant kitchens From Template to Installation: What Homeowners Should Expect Typical Timeline and Scheduling Insights from Pacific Stone SoCal Homeowners often worry about lengthy renovation timelines and scheduling chaos, but Riley Tatton assures that a disciplined process should keep surprises to a minimum.
